CNC Machining Surface Finishing Processes: Types, Effects and Application Scenarios

29 Jun, 2026 1:53pm

Surface finishing is an essential procedure for high-quality CNC machined parts. It not only improves the appearance of mechanical components, but also greatly enhances corrosion resistance, wear resistance, surface hardness and service life.

Main Surface Treatment Processes

Anodizing: Mainly used for aluminum parts. It forms a dense oxide film on the surface to improve corrosion resistance and achieve colorful decorative effects.

Sandblasting: Uniformly removes tool marks, makes the surface matte and delicate, improves coating adhesion.

Mirror Polishing: Reduces surface roughness to Ra0.2 or higher, suitable for precision fitting parts and appearance parts.

Plating and Nickel Coating: Improves hardness, wear resistance and rust prevention for steel and copper parts.

Heat Treatment: Quenching and tempering improve structural hardness and mechanical strength of mechanical parts.
